Queasy

Denial isn't healthy, but it's easy:
The easiest, indeed, of all the ways
To deal with things that make you kind of queasy, 
And muddle on in an unreasoned haze.
But being easy doesn't make it right;
It's safer to be fully self-aware.
For in your heart of hearts your second sight
Will tell you what, perhaps, you do not dare
Admit self-consciously - what you deny
Is still out there, still looming, still to come.
And if you choose to give yourself the lie,
It may be easy, but it sure is dumb.
So I'll admit I'm leaving, and be sad
Rather than pretend - and then go mad.
